How to Make Your Pitbull Muscular the Healthy Way

The desire to cultivate a muscular physique in a Pitbull is understandable, given the breed’s natural athleticism and powerful build. Achieving this goal responsibly means focusing on health, which involves a precise combination of genetics, specialized nutrition, and structured exercise. The aim is to develop a lean, functional body that supports the dog’s overall well-being, rather than simply creating bulk. A healthy, muscular dog results from a balanced lifestyle where diet and training maximize natural potential.

Understanding the Pitbull’s Natural Build

The Pitbull type, particularly the American Pitbull Terrier, possesses a genetic predisposition for a powerful, mesomorphic body structure. This natural musculature results from selective breeding for active, working dogs, giving them a naturally lower body-fat density and prominent chest and leg muscles. This foundation means they respond well to conditioning.

Genetics ultimately determine the maximum size and shape a dog can achieve; no amount of training can override the dog’s inherited blueprint. Some Pitbull lines are naturally stockier, while others are leaner, influencing the final physique. The goal should be to achieve a healthy, defined muscle tone that is functional and athletic, avoiding an over-bulked appearance that can strain joints.

Fueling Muscle Development Through Diet

Muscle growth is supported by a diet rich in high-quality protein, which provides the amino acids necessary for tissue repair and synthesis. For an active, muscular dog, a diet with a guaranteed protein level of 26% or higher on a dry matter basis is recommended to support energy needs and fuel muscle turnover. This protein should come primarily from highly digestible, animal-based sources like meat, rather than plant-based fillers.

Calorie density is important, as the dog must consume enough energy to support intense exercise without gaining excess fat. Performance diets often feature a higher fat content, sometimes in the 25–35% dry matter range, because fat is the most concentrated source of energy for working dogs. This high-energy intake supports the sustained activity required for muscle building and helps maintain a healthy coat.

The nutrient profile must match the dog’s specific activity level. Owners should exercise caution regarding human supplements, such as creatine or protein powders, as these are not formulated for canine metabolism and should only be used under veterinary guidance. A veterinarian can help determine the optimal balance of protein, fat, and carbohydrates based on the dog’s age and training regimen.

Targeted Exercise and Training Methods

A structured training regimen must incorporate a mix of resistance, endurance, and explosive movements to build a well-rounded, muscular physique. Resistance training is effective for building dense muscle mass; activities like controlled weight pulling with a specialized harness can be introduced gradually. When using a weighted vest, start with a light load (5 to 10 percent of the dog’s body weight) and increase it slowly to avoid joint strain.

A spring pole develops the powerful jaw, neck, and shoulder muscles by providing isometric resistance. The dog engages in a sustained tugging motion, which builds strength and endurance in the upper body. These resistance exercises should be balanced with cardio and endurance work, such as swimming, which offers a low-impact, full-body workout gentle on the joints.

Explosive movements, like short sprints, hill running, or using a flirt pole, help develop fast-twitch muscle fibers for power and agility. Consistency is important, and training sessions should be engaging for the dog. Proper form must be monitored closely, as poor movement during high-intensity exercise can lead to injury.

Prioritizing Safety and Recovery

Before beginning any intensive muscle-building program, a comprehensive veterinary check-up is necessary to ensure the dog is structurally sound and healthy enough for the increased physical demands. This is particularly important for ruling out underlying joint or heart conditions that could be exacerbated by strenuous exercise. The long-term health of the dog depends on allowing adequate time for recovery.

Signs of overtraining include excessive fatigue lasting beyond the normal recovery period, reluctance to engage in activities, or physical symptoms like limping or stiffness. Muscle repair and growth (protein turnover) occur during rest, making rest days necessary for building a muscular physique. A schedule that includes 24 to 48 hours of rest between intense sessions allows muscle fibers to rebuild stronger.

Every training session should begin with a warm-up, such as a brisk walk or light jog, and end with a cool-down period. Maintaining optimal hydration is a safety measure, especially during high-intensity or warm-weather training. Monitoring the dog’s behavior and physical condition ensures the training program remains healthy and positive.
